    Abstract: This dataset contains the geologic map units, grouped by fundamental terrain type, of the island of Guam.
    Purpose: This dataset was developed to provide up-to-date GIS coverage of geologic information that reflects the recent update of the Geologic Map of Guam (2008) by Siegrist and Reagan. The map was originally published in 2008 as a 1:50,000-scale hard-copy map and in digital format as PDFs consisting of nine 1:24,000-scale and one 1:50,000-scale.       Process_Description: All nine (9) Geologic Map of Guam quadrangle maps (1:24,000) in PDF-format were exported to TIFF in Adobe Photoshop. Each map was then imported to ArcMap and georeferenced using the four corners of each map for ground control points (GCPs). The Total RSME Error for each quadrangle map was between 0.27 and 0.65 meter. A first order polynomial (affine) transformation was used to rectify the images. The 1:50,000  map covering all of Guam was also rectified using over 50 GCPs. However, it was only used as reference and not as source data since it did not overlay the USGS topographic maps (DRGs) and the WorldView2 satellite imagery as well as the quadrangle maps.

      Horizontal_Positional_Accuracy_Report: The polygons were created by tracing the nine (9) georeferenced Geologic Map of Guam quadrangle maps (1:24,000). The quadrangle topo maps follow the National Map Accuracy Standard. The geologic map is likely to follow that standard although no documentation was found to support that. Additional errors may have been introduced by geo-referencing and/ or digitizing. However, both types of errors are believed to be minor as geo-referencing was done by using the coordinates of the four corners of each map as ground control points; the georefernced maps overlaid well the USGS topo maps (< 10 meter discrepancy) and WorldView2 satellite imagery. Also, the outlines of the polygons were traced using ArcScan and should therefore be identical to the scanned georeferenced map. No positional accuracy assessment has been performed in the field.
